Low-fact labels: Our tests expose biscuits with three times more saturated fat and pizza with 80 per cent extra fat than the labels claim

Article Abstract:

Nutrition labels on food are important but the results of tests conducted on 70 foods showed that they can be very inaccurate with just seven percent of the 570 nutrients matching up exactly with what the label indicated. Companies blamed variations in ingredients or recipes for such misleading nutrient labels and hence it is suggested that manufacturers should strive to make the information as accurate as possible to avoid making false claims.

Home cinema: Watching films at home with surround-sound is great - but choose carefully for the best effect

Article Abstract:

The market for home-cinema sound systems is growing, driven by the popularity of DVD players and widescreen TVs. The main elements of a surround-sound system for the home cinema are the speakers and amplifier and some of the best in this category are Panasonic, Sharp, Denon, Acoustic Energy and Yamaha/Wharfedale.
